Seattle Audubon Society holds 5 U.S. trademarks filed with the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O), with a strong focus on Class 41 (Education & Entertainment) — 3 filings in this category. The portfolio also extends into Class 25 (Clothing) across 7 Nice Classification classes. Currently, 4 trademarks are registered. Notable registered marks include BIRDNOTE and BIRDS CONNECT SEATTLE. The owner is based in Seattle, WA.
